File tree Expand file tree Collapse file tree 6 files changed +9
-26
lines changed
src/main/java/xyz/theprogramsrc/supercoreapi Expand file tree Collapse file tree 6 files changed +9
-26
lines changed Original file line number Diff line number Diff line change 11## v4.2.13 Changelog:
22```
3- * Bungee Bug Fixes
3+ * Moved Log Filter register method to the LogsFilter class
44```
55
66## v4.2.12 Changelog:
Original file line number Diff line number Diff line change 66
77 <groupId >xyz.theprogramsrc</groupId >
88 <artifactId >SuperCoreAPI</artifactId >
9- <version >4.2.13_BETA </version >
9+ <version >4.2.13_BETA2 </version >
1010 <packaging >jar</packaging >
1111
1212 <name >SuperCoreAPI</name >
Original file line number Diff line number Diff line change 11package xyz .theprogramsrc .supercoreapi ;
22
3- import xyz .theprogramsrc .supercoreapi .global .LogsFilter ;
43import xyz .theprogramsrc .supercoreapi .global .data .PluginDataStorage ;
54import xyz .theprogramsrc .supercoreapi .global .dependencies .DependencyManager ;
65import xyz .theprogramsrc .supercoreapi .global .translations .TranslationManager ;
@@ -154,12 +153,6 @@ default void addDisableHook(Runnable runnable){
154153 */
155154 void emergencyStop ();
156155
157- /**
158- * Registers a log filter
159- * @param logsFilter the filter
160- */
161- void registerLogFilter (LogsFilter logsFilter );
162-
163156 /**
164157 * Gets the plugin data storage
165158 * @return the plugin data storage
Original file line number Diff line number Diff line change 99import xyz .theprogramsrc .supercoreapi .bungee .storage .Settings ;
1010import xyz .theprogramsrc .supercoreapi .bungee .utils .BungeeUtils ;
1111import xyz .theprogramsrc .supercoreapi .bungee .utils .tasks .BungeeTasks ;
12- import xyz .theprogramsrc .supercoreapi .global .LogsFilter ;
1312import xyz .theprogramsrc .supercoreapi .global .data .PluginDataStorage ;
1413import xyz .theprogramsrc .supercoreapi .global .dependencies .Dependencies ;
1514import xyz .theprogramsrc .supercoreapi .global .dependencies .DependencyManager ;
@@ -216,10 +215,4 @@ public LinkedList<Exception> getLastErrors() {
216215 public void addError (Exception e ){
217216 this .errors .add (e );
218217 }
219-
220- @ Override
221- public void registerLogFilter (LogsFilter logsFilter ){
222- org .apache .logging .log4j .core .Logger consoleLogger = ((org .apache .logging .log4j .core .Logger ) org .apache .logging .log4j .LogManager .getRootLogger ());
223- consoleLogger .addFilter (logsFilter );
224- }
225218}
Original file line number Diff line number Diff line change 11package xyz .theprogramsrc .supercoreapi .global ;
22
33import org .apache .logging .log4j .Level ;
4+ import org .apache .logging .log4j .LogManager ;
45import org .apache .logging .log4j .Marker ;
56import org .apache .logging .log4j .core .LogEvent ;
67import org .apache .logging .log4j .core .Logger ;
@@ -35,6 +36,11 @@ private Result process(String message){
3536 return Result .NEUTRAL ;
3637 }
3738
39+ public void register (){
40+ Logger consoleLogger = ((Logger ) LogManager .getRootLogger ());
41+ consoleLogger .addFilter (this );
42+ }
43+
3844 @ Override
3945 public Result filter (LogEvent event ) {
4046 return this .process (event .getMessage ().getFormattedMessage ());
@@ -63,7 +69,7 @@ public String[] getExtraRequirements(){
6369 return new String [0 ];
6470 }
6571
66- public static enum FilterResult {
72+ public enum FilterResult {
6773 DENY ,
6874 NEUTRAL ,
6975 NONE
Original file line number Diff line number Diff line change 11package xyz .theprogramsrc .supercoreapi .spigot ;
22
3- import org .apache .logging .log4j .LogManager ;
4- import org .apache .logging .log4j .core .Logger ;
53import org .bukkit .configuration .ConfigurationSection ;
64import org .bukkit .event .HandlerList ;
75import org .bukkit .event .Listener ;
86import org .bukkit .plugin .java .JavaPlugin ;
97import xyz .theprogramsrc .supercoreapi .SuperPlugin ;
108import xyz .theprogramsrc .supercoreapi .SuperUtils ;
11- import xyz .theprogramsrc .supercoreapi .global .LogsFilter ;
129import xyz .theprogramsrc .supercoreapi .global .data .PluginDataStorage ;
1310import xyz .theprogramsrc .supercoreapi .global .dependencies .Dependencies ;
1411import xyz .theprogramsrc .supercoreapi .global .dependencies .DependencyManager ;
@@ -309,10 +306,4 @@ public LinkedList<Exception> getLastErrors() {
309306 public void addError (Exception e ){
310307 this .errors .add (e );
311308 }
312-
313- @ Override
314- public void registerLogFilter (LogsFilter logsFilter ){
315- Logger consoleLogger = (Logger ) LogManager .getRootLogger ();
316- consoleLogger .addFilter (logsFilter );
317- }
318309}
You can’t perform that action at this time.
0 commit comments